Prayers for Weary Moms

Motherhood can be deeply rewarding, but it can also leave a woman physically, emotionally, and spiritually drained. Between caring for children, managing responsibilities, and carrying the unseen burdens of family life, many moms quietly battle exhaustion and discouragement. In those weary moments, prayer becomes a place of comfort and renewal. God sees every sacrifice, every sleepless night, and every tear that goes unnoticed by others. These prayers are written to encourage tired mothers who need strength, peace, hope, and rest. Whether facing overwhelming days or simply longing for fresh encouragement, these heartfelt prayers can help draw weary hearts closer to God’s sustaining presence.

Prayers for a Weary Mom

#1. A Prayer for Strength in Exhausting Seasons

Dear God,

Today feels heavy, and exhaustion has settled deep within my heart and body. The responsibilities before me seem endless, and sometimes I wonder how I will continue carrying them all. Please renew my strength when weariness tries to overtake me. Help me to remember that I do not have to rely only on my own abilities because Your power is made perfect in weakness. Give me endurance for today’s challenges and peace for tomorrow’s uncertainties. Fill my heart with courage when discouragement rises and remind me that every act of love and care matters in Your eyes. Sustain me with Your unfailing grace.

Amen.

#2. A Prayer for Rest Beyond Physical Tiredness

Heavenly Father,

My soul feels tired in ways that sleep alone cannot fix. The demands of life have left my heart restless and overwhelmed. I ask You to lead me into true rest that comes only from Your presence. Quiet the anxious thoughts that keep my mind racing and help me release the burdens I was never meant to carry alone. Teach me to pause and trust that You are in control even when everything feels unfinished. Refresh my spirit and restore joy where exhaustion has taken root. Let Your peace settle deeply within me and remind me that I am safe in Your loving care.

Amen.

#3. A Prayer for Patience During Overwhelming Days

Dear Lord,

Some days test my patience more than I expect, and frustration rises quickly when I feel overwhelmed. In those difficult moments, help me respond with gentleness instead of anger and understanding instead of impatience. Give me wisdom to handle stressful situations with grace and compassion. Remind me that my children need love and guidance even when I feel exhausted myself. Help me not to speak harsh words out of weariness or discouragement. Fill my heart with calmness when chaos surrounds me and teach me to slow down when emotions run high. May Your Spirit guide my reactions and strengthen my heart each day.

Amen.

#4. A Prayer for Peace in the Middle of Chaos

Dear God,

Life feels noisy and chaotic, and sometimes I struggle to find peace within the constant demands around me. My heart longs for calmness in the middle of busy schedules, endless tasks, and emotional pressure. Please quiet the storms inside my mind and help me focus on Your steady presence. Remind me that You are near even during stressful moments and difficult days. Give me the ability to breathe deeply and trust You when everything feels out of control. Let Your peace guard my heart from fear, worry, and frustration. Help me create a home filled with love, patience, and the comfort that comes from You alone.

Amen.

#5. A Prayer for a Discouraged Mother’s Heart

Heavenly Father,

There are moments when discouragement settles heavily on my heart, making me feel unseen and inadequate. I sometimes question whether I am doing enough or making a difference at all. Please remind me that my worth is not measured by perfection or productivity but by Your love for me. Strengthen me when self-doubt tries to steal my confidence and replace discouragement with hope. Help me see the beauty in small acts of faithfulness and love. Encourage my heart when I feel emotionally drained and alone. Let me find comfort in knowing that You walk beside me through every challenge and every weary moment.

Amen.

#6. A Prayer for Joy After Endless Responsibilities

Dear Lord,

The endless responsibilities of motherhood sometimes leave little room for joy. I become so focused on what needs to be done that I forget to appreciate the blessings around me. Today I ask You to restore gladness to my heart and help me find joy even in ordinary moments. Open my eyes to the beauty of laughter, family, and simple daily blessings. Help me not to lose myself in exhaustion and routine. Teach me to celebrate small victories and cherish meaningful moments with those I love. Fill my spirit with renewed happiness and remind me that joy can still grow in weary seasons.

Amen.

#7. A Prayer for Grace When Feeling Unappreciated

Dear God,

Sometimes I feel unnoticed and unappreciated for all the sacrifices I quietly make each day. The work of motherhood can feel invisible, and discouragement easily follows when gratitude seems absent. Please help me not to grow bitter or resentful in those moments. Remind me that You see every effort, every act of kindness, and every expression of love that others may overlook. Fill my heart with grace and humility instead of frustration. Help me continue serving my family with compassion and patience even when recognition does not come. Let my identity rest securely in Your love rather than in the approval of others.

Amen.

#8. A Prayer for Hope During Difficult Motherhood Moments

Heavenly Father,

Some seasons of motherhood feel especially difficult, and hope can seem distant during overwhelming moments. When challenges arise and emotions feel heavy, help me remember that You are still working even when I cannot see immediate change. Strengthen my faith when fear and discouragement try to take over my thoughts. Remind me that difficult seasons do not last forever and that Your plans are always filled with purpose and hope. Give me wisdom for hard decisions and courage to keep moving forward. Help me trust that You are guiding my family with love and care through every uncertain moment.

Amen.

#9. A Prayer for Comfort When Carrying Too Much

Dear Lord,

There are days when the emotional weight I carry feels unbearable. Responsibilities, worries, and hidden struggles press heavily upon my heart, leaving me exhausted and discouraged. Please comfort me when I feel overwhelmed and remind me that I do not have to carry every burden alone. Teach me to surrender my fears and anxieties into Your hands. Surround me with Your presence and strengthen me when I feel weak. Help me release unrealistic expectations and embrace the grace You freely offer. Let Your comfort renew my spirit and remind me that Your love is strong enough to sustain me through every challenge I face.

Amen.

#10. A Prayer for Renewal for a Tired and Weary Mom

Dear God,

I come before You feeling weary in body, mind, and spirit. The constant demands of life have drained my energy, and I desperately need renewal. Please breathe fresh strength into my heart and restore the passion and hope that exhaustion has weakened. Help me find moments of stillness where I can reconnect with You and receive the peace my soul longs for. Teach me to care for myself without guilt and to trust that rest is part of Your design. Fill me with renewed purpose, patience, and joy so I can continue loving my family with a refreshed and strengthened heart.

Amen.
